I am the sole maintainer and packager of openSUSE lilypond and I have a build failure in factory builds that appears to be guile related,
unfortunately guile is new to me and I'm battling to get all the packages used by lilypond synced up and built for 11.4 in
home:plater:lilypond. I've also had an unfortunate internet disconnection from the end of June to the middle of August which has set me
back some.
The failure is :
make[1]: Entering directory
`/usr/src/packages/BUILD/lilypond-2.14.2/Documentation'
mkdir -p ./out
touch ./out/dummy.dep
echo '*' > ./out/.gitignore
make[1]: Leaving directory
`/usr/src/packages/BUILD/lilypond-2.14.2/Documentation'
make[1]: Entering directory
`/usr/src/packages/BUILD/lilypond-2.14.2/Documentation'
cd ./out && /usr/src/packages/BUILD/lilypond-2.14.2/out/bin/lilypond --verbose
/usr/src/packages/BUILD/lilypond-2.14.2/ly/generate-documentation
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/staff-notation.itely
--template=snippets/staff-notation-intro.itely < snippets/staff-notation.snippet-list
lys-to-tely: writing out/staff-notation.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/ancient-notation.itely
--template=snippets/ancient-notation-intro.itely < snippets/ancient-notation.snippet-list
lys-to-tely: writing out/ancient-notation.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/spacing.itely
--template=snippets/spacing-intro.itely < snippets/spacing.snippet-list
lys-to-tely: writing out/spacing.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/template.itely
--template=snippets/template-intro.itely < snippets/template.snippet-list
warning: Relocation: is absolute:
argv0=/usr/src/packages/BUILD/lilypond-2.14.2/out/bin/lilypond
PATH=/usr/src/packages/BUILD/lilypond-2.14.2/out/bin (prepend)
Setting PATH to
/usr/src/packages/BUILD/lilypond-2.14.2/out/bin:/usr/src/packages/BUILD/lilypond-2.14.2/lily/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/out:/usr/src/packages/BUILD/lilypond-2.14.2/lily/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/out:/usr/local/bin:/usr/bin:/bin:/usr/X11R6/bin:/usr/games:.::
warning: Relocation: compile datadir=, new
datadir=/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ond//current
warning: Relocation:
framework_prefix=/usr/src/packages/BUILD/lilypond-2.14.2/out/bin/..
Setting INSTALLER_PREFIX to /usr/src/packages/BUILD/lilypond-2.14.2/out/bin/..
PATH=/usr/src/packages/BUILD/lilypond-2.14.2/out/bin/../bin (prepend)
Setting PATH to
/usr/src/packages/BUILD/lilypond-2.14.2/out/bin/../bin:/usr/src/packages/BUILD/lilypond-2.14.2/out/bin:/usr/src/packages/BUILD/lilypond-2.14.2/lily/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/out:/usr/src/packages/BUILD/lilypond-2.14.2/lily/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/out:/usr/local/bin:/usr/bin:/bin:/usr/X11R6/bin:/usr/games:.::
Setting GUILE_MIN_YIELD_1 to 65
Setting GUILE_MIN_YIELD_2 to 65
Setting GUILE_MIN_YIELD_MALLOC to 65
Setting GUILE_INIT_SEGMENT_SIZE_1 to 10485760
Setting GUILE_MAX_SEGMENT_SIZE to 104857600
lys-to-tely: writing out/template.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/rhythms.itely
--template=snippets/rhythms-intro.itely < snippets/rhythms.snippet-list
lys-to-tely: writing out/rhythms.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/pitches.itely
--template=snippets/pitches-intro.itely < snippets/pitches.snippet-list
LILYPOND_DATADIR="/usr/share/lilypond/2.14.2"
LOCALEDIR="/usr/share/locale"
Effective prefix:
"/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current"
GS_LIB="/home/abuild/.fonts:/usr/src/packages/BUILD/lilypond-2.14.2/mf/out"
PATH="/usr/src/packages/BUILD/lilypond-2.14.2/out/bin/../bin:/usr/src/packages/BUILD/lilypond-2.14.2/out/bin:/usr/src/packages/BUILD/lilypond-2.14.2/lily/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/out:/usr/src/packages/BUILD/lilypond-2.14.2/lily/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out:/usr/src/packages/BUILD/lilypond-2.14.2/scripts/out:/usr/local/bin:/usr/bin:/bin:/usr/X11R6/bin:/usr/games:.::"
lys-to-tely: writing out/pitches.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/expressive-marks.itely
--template=snippets/expressive-marks-intro.itely < snippets/expressive-marks.snippet-list
[]
lys-to-tely: writing out/expressive-marks.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im
--name=out/simultaneous-notes.itely --template=snippets/simultaneous-notes-intro.itely < snippets/simultaneous-notes.snippet-list
lys-to-tely: writing out/simultaneous-notes.itely...
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/repeats.itely
--template=snippets/repeats-intro.itely < snippets/repeats.snippet-list
Using (ice-9 curried-definitions) module
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/lily-library.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/file-cache.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-event-classes.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-music-callbacks.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-music-types.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-note-names.scm]
lys-to-tely: writing
out/repeats.itely...[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/output-lib.scm
xargs /usr/src/packages/BUILD/lilypond-2.14.2/scripts/build/out/lys-to-tely -f doctitle,texidoc,verbatim --name=out/world-music.itely
--template=snippets/world-music-intro.itely < snippets/world-music.snippet-list
]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/c++.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/chord-ignatzek-names.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/chord-entry.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/chord-generic-names.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/stencil.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/markup.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/modal-transforms.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/music-functions.scm[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-music-display-methods.scm]
]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/part-combiner.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/autochange.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-music-properties.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/time-signature-settings.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/auto-beam.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/bezier-tools.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/parser-ly-from-scheme.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/ly-syntax-constructors.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-context-properties.scm]
[/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/define-markup-commands.scm
error: Not a markup command: line
/usr/src/packages/BUILD/lilypond-2.14.2/out/share/lilypond/current/scm/lily.scm;;;
note: auto-compilation is enabled, set GUILE_AUTO_COMPILE=0
;;; or pass the --no-auto-compile argument to disable.
;;; compiling
/usr/src/packages/BUILD/lilypond-2.14.2/scm/define-markup-commands.scm
make[1]: *** [out/internals.texi] Error 1
make[1]: *** Waiting for unfinished jobs....
lys-to-tely: writing out/world-music.itely...
make[1]: Leaving directory
`/usr/src/packages/BUILD/lilypond-2.14.2/Documentation'
make: *** [all] Error 2
error: Bad exit status from /var/tmp/rpm-tmp.dHWerx (%build)
RPM build errors:
Bad exit status from /var/tmp/rpm-tmp.dHWerx (%build)
The buildroot was: /data/packages/build-root
The 11.4 build succeeds but chokes during the documentation build on a ghostscript error, don't know if factory will get past it yet. gs
errors I can cope with but guile is unfamiliar territory and 12.1 beta's deadline is next Thursday. Any useful links to a guile quick error
reference also appreciated.
This link should take you to the lilypond package in the build service:
https://build.opensuse.org/package/show?package=lilypond&project=home%3Aplater%3Alilypond#
, I can't copy the link to the build log atm because the package is blocked by other dependants builds and the build log is too big for
paste bin, I'll xz it up and try to attach it to a reply to this mail, failing that I'll check it in to the build service and email the link.
Thanks
Dave Plater
Maintainer multimedia openSUSE
_______________________________________________
lilypond-devel mailing list
lilypond-devel@gnu.org
https://lists.gnu.org/mailman/listinfo/lilypond-devel